Sylvia
Meaning
Sylvia is a female given name and is of Latin origin. It means forest or woods. Pronounced as sil-vee-uh, the name is currently in the top 10 of NameChef Most Popular Baby Names and in the top 500 of U.S birth chart of the year 2022. Variations of Sylvia include Silvia.
The name Sylvia originates from the Latin forest "Silva", which means the spirit of the wood. The variation Silvia, was brought to England by William Shakespeare in his poem “Who is Silvia? What is she, That all our swains commend her?”. In Roman mythology, Silvia is the goddess of the forest and the mother of the mythical twins Remus and Romulus, who were the founders of Rome.
Here are some potential nicknames for Sylvia: Sil, Silvi, Vivi, Via.
